Hey Priya — handing over the Quillbase static-analysis setup. Heads up: the baseline file (`sa-baseline.yml`) suppresses about 140 legacy findings so new PRs stay clean. Don't let anyone add fresh suppressions without a ticket — that's the whole game. I've been burning down roughly ten entries a sprint. The suppression policy and the burn-down tracker are on the page below.

runbook for fajep-yahop: https://rundeck.braskdata.example/repo/run/pages/job/dfe5b8c563356906

## Ownership

This module implements role-based access for the Thistlegate wiki: role definitions, grant propagation, and the audit log writer. Reviewers should check that any change to permission evaluation includes updated fixture tests and a migration note, since grants are cached per-session. Do not approve changes touching the Steward role without a second review. Final review authority for this module rests with the person named below.

account owner for bawip-fajeg: Ralix Oliwyn

Subject: Key rotation — Mergemint dedup service

As part of our quarterly rotation, credentials for Mergemint, the internal service that deduplicates customer records, have been rotated effective today. Reviewers: when checking pull requests against the dedup pipeline this week, please confirm that no branch still references the retired credential in fixtures or config samples — the old key is now invalid and any test run using it will fail at the matching stage. For local verification of dedup behavior, use the new key below.

gateway credential: kto3_qfe

## Step 4 — Health checks behind Brindlegate

Switch the Orvela service to the new health endpoint before enrolling nodes in the Brindlegate balancer. Old /ping returns 200 even during warmup; new /healthz does not. Do not mix endpoints across the pool. Verify two clean probe cycles before draining legacy nodes. Apply the following probe configuration.

config for yajep-tafof:
[rusath]
team = julmir
access_code = ac_fe37fd
host = rusath.novactech.test
port = 8000
owner = pelmir.weneth
peer = oliwyn.olvarqdyn.internal